EPS 70 100mm insulation is a type of rigid foam insulation that is commonly used in walls, floors, and roofs It has a high thermal resistance, making it an effective way to reduce heat loss and improve energy efficiency in buildings This type of insulation is also lightweight, easy to install, and resistant to moisture, making it a durable and long-lasting option for a variety of applications.
One of the key benefits of EPS 70 100mm insulation is its high thermal resistance, which is measured by its R-value The R-value of insulation measures its ability to resist heat flow, with a higher R-value indicating better insulation performance EPS 70 100mm insulation has a high R-value, making it an effective way to keep buildings warm in the winter and cool in the summer By using EPS 70 100mm insulation in your construction projects, you can reduce the need for additional heating and cooling systems, leading to lower energy costs and a smaller carbon footprint.
In addition to its thermal resistance, EPS 70 100mm insulation is also lightweight and easy to install Unlike other types of insulation, which can be heavy and difficult to work with, EPS 70 100mm insulation is easy to handle and can be cut to fit any size or shape This makes it a versatile option for a variety of projects, from new construction to renovations Whether you are insulating a new building or upgrading an existing one, EPS 70 100mm insulation is a cost-effective and efficient solution.
